In some applications, it may be necessary for a device to wake up very
quickly in order to begin operation. The Cyclone III device family offers
the fast POR time option to support fast wake-up time applications. The
fast POR time option has stricter power up requirements compared to the
standard POR time option. You can select either the fast POR option or the
standard POR option using the MSEL pin settings.

Configuration and JTAG Pin I/O Requirements
Cyclone III devices are manufactured using TSMC’s 65-nm low-k
dielectric process. Although Cyclone III devices use TSMC 2.5-V
transistor technology in I/O buffers, the devices are compatible and able
to interface with 2.5V/3.0V/3.3V configuration voltage standards.
However, you must follow specific requirements when interfacing
Cyclone III devices with 2.5V/3.0V/3.3V configuration voltage
standards.
The fast POR time feature in Cyclone III devices is similar to the
Fast-On feature in Cyclone II devices designated with an “A” in
the ordering code.
The Cyclone III devices’ fast wake-up time meets the
requirement of common bus standards in automotive
applications, such as Media Orientated Systems Transport
(MOST) and Controller Area Network (CAN).
